California Legal Code

§ 32352

Ask AI about this
32352. Any member shall be retired for disability regardless of age or amount of service, if incapacitated for the performance of duty as the result of an injury or disease occurring in and arising out of the course of his employment. Any member otherwise incapacitated for the performance of duty shall be retired regardless of age, but only after 10 years of service. Incapacity for performance of duty shall be determined by the board. As used in this section, 'service' means only service for which contribution provided for in this chapter has been made as a county forester, firewarden, or fireman.(Added by Stats. 1947, Ch. 424.)
